About this task
You can edit the name, IP address range, user name, and password of a Remote Collector based on your preference.
Steps
1. Point to Extensions and click Manage Remote Collectors.
The Remote Collectors page is displayed.
2. Select the Remote Collector you want to edit and click Edit.
The Edit Remote Collector window is displayed.
3. Edit the name, IP address range, user name, password, proxy details, and the proxy exclusion list as required.
4. Click Update.

Deleting Remote Collector
Prerequisites
You must be logged in to SupportAssist Enterprise with elevated or administrative privileges. See Granting elevated or
administrative privileges to users.
About this task
You can delete a Remote Collector from SupportAssist Enterprise based on your preference.
CAUTION: Deleting the Remote Collector will also delete all collections that are saved on the remote system.
Steps
1. Point to Extensions and click Manage Remote Collectors.
The Remote Collectors page is displayed.
2. Select the Remote Collector you want to delete and click Delete.
The Remove Remote Collector window is displayed.
3. Click Remove Remote Collector.
The Remote Collector is removed from SupportAssist Enterprise and the Remote Collector application is uninstalled from the
remote system. Collection and upload of system information from all devices that were associated with the Remote Collector
are now associated with the server running SupportAssist Enterprise.
